Following a tour of Europe earlier this year and his OVO Fest this summer, Drake is set to head back out on the road. The GRAMMY winner will extend his The Boy Meets World Tour with dates in Australia and New Zealand in November.

Drake will kick off the six-date tour on Nov. 3 in Auckland, New Zealand, with his run wrapping with two nights at the Rod Laver Arena in Melbourne, Australia, on Nov. 18 and Nov. 20. Tickets go on sale Sept. 15.
In related Drizzy news, the Canadian rapper announced a donation of $200,000 for Hurricane Harvey relief via Houston Texans defensive end J.J. Watt's charitable foundation.
"To the resilient people of Houston and the entire state of Texas, I would like to send you all of our love and all of our prayers," Drake said in an Instagram post. "To the brave men and women that have assisted in aid, relief [and] rescue, your actions are truly heroic."
